[0001] The present invention relates to the technical field of air conditioners, and in particular to a fresh air device and an air conditioner cabinet having the same. Background Art
[0002] Currently, some air conditioners are equipped with fresh air devices to supply fresh air to the interior, reducing air stagnation and improving the user experience. Furthermore, some fresh air devices also have exhaust ducts to dissipate indoor air to prevent excessive carbon dioxide concentrations that can lead to reduced comfort. However, existing fresh air devices require different valves to open and close different airflow channels to achieve this exhaust function, resulting in complex valve structures and low reliability. [0003] The first purpose of the present invention is to provide a fresh air device to solve the technical problem that the existing fresh air device requires different valves to open or close different air flow channels to achieve the exhaust function, resulting in complex valve structure and low reliability.
[0004] The fresh air device provided by the present invention includes a shell, a fan assembly and a first valve. The shell is provided with an exhaust port and a first air port. The exhaust port is connected to the indoor room, and the first air port is connected to the outdoor room. The fan assembly is arranged in the inner cavity of the shell, and the fan assembly has an air inlet side and an air outlet side. The first valve has an exhaust state for discharging indoor air through the first air port. In the exhaust state, the first valve opens the exhaust port to connect the indoor room with the air inlet side, closes the air flow channel from the air outlet side to the indoor room, and connects the sewage air channel from the air outlet side to the first air port.
[0005] When it is necessary to use the fresh air device to exhaust the indoor air to the outdoors, the first valve can be switched to the exhaust state. At this time, the first valve opens the exhaust port to connect the indoor room with the air inlet side, closes the air flow channel from the air outlet side to the indoor room, and connects the sewage air channel from the air outlet side to the first air port, so that the indoor air can flow from the exhaust port to the air inlet side under the action of the fan assembly, and when the above air flows out from the air outlet side, it will not enter the room, but will flow to the first air port through the sewage air channel to be discharged to the outdoors.
[0006] The above-mentioned setting of the fresh air device can not only discharge indoor air to the outdoors, reduce the indoor carbon dioxide concentration and improve comfort, but also make the three channels from the exhaust port to the air inlet side, the air outlet side to the indoor room and the air outlet side to the first air outlet arranged adjacent to each other, so that the air flow channels of the fresh air device are arranged reasonably and compactly. Only by using the first valve in the exhaust state, the opening or closing of the three channels from the exhaust port to the air inlet side, the air outlet side to the indoor room and the air outlet side to the first air outlet can be managed. The design is ingenious, the valve structure is simple and the reliability is high.
[0007] Furthermore, the first valve also has a fresh air state for allowing outdoor air to enter the room. In this fresh air state, the first valve closes the exhaust port to block the indoor air from the air inlet side, opens the airflow path from the air outlet side to the indoor air, and closes the sewage air path. This configuration allows the first valve to still manage the opening or closing of the three channels: the exhaust port to the air inlet side, the air outlet side to the indoor air, and the air outlet side to the first air port, even when in the fresh air state, thereby satisfying the fresh air supply function of the fresh air device.
[0008] Furthermore, the inner cavity of the shell includes an air guide cavity and a receiving cavity separated by a partition, the cavity wall of the air guide cavity is provided with a second air outlet directly connected to the indoor room; the fan assembly is arranged in the receiving cavity, the exhaust air channel is formed in the receiving cavity, the first air outlet is provided in the cavity wall of the receiving cavity; the exhaust outlet is provided in the partition, and the partition is also provided with an air inlet. This arrangement of the fresh air device uses a partition to separate the inner cavity of the shell into an air guide cavity directly connected to the indoor room and a receiving cavity directly connected to the outdoor room, and by providing an exhaust outlet and an air inlet on the partition, it ensures that indoor air is discharged to the outdoor room and outdoor air is supplied to the indoor room, and has a simple structure.
[0009] Furthermore, the first valve is movably disposed on the partition, and includes a first valve body and a second valve body connected at an angle, with the second valve body facing the entrance of the exhaust air passage. In the exhaust state, the first valve body closes the air inlet and exposes the exhaust port, while the second valve body connects the air outlet side with the exhaust air passage. In the fresh air state, the first valve body exposes the air inlet and closes the exhaust port, while the second valve body blocks the air outlet side from the exhaust air passage. This arrangement of the first valve allows switching between the exhaust state and the fresh air state through a simple movement process, simplifying control.
[0010] Furthermore, the air inlet and the air outlet are arranged at intervals along the moving direction of the first valve. This arrangement is beneficial for reducing the width of the first valve body.
[0011] Furthermore, the first valve body is vertically connected to the second valve body, the second valve body being a plate-shaped structure, and the side of the second valve body facing the exhaust air passage is used to close the exhaust air passage. With this arrangement, when the first valve is moved to the fresh air state, the exhaust air passage can be closed using the side of the second valve body facing the exhaust air passage, resulting in a simple structure and reducing the cost of the first valve.
[0012] Furthermore, the exhaust air duct is partially recessed around its inlet, away from the second valve body, to form a mating stop. In the fresh air state, the second valve body is embedded in the mating stop. This arrangement allows the second valve body to form a labyrinthine groove seal at the exhaust air duct inlet by embedding with the mating stop after the fresh air is discharged from the air outlet side, thereby preventing fresh air from leaking into the exhaust air duct.
[0013] Furthermore, the second valve body includes a connecting edge and a sealing edge. The connecting edge is used to connect to the first valve body, and the sealing edge is provided with a rib running along its direction, and the rib is located on the side of the second valve body facing the exhaust air duct. The surface of the mating stop facing the second valve body forms a mating surface, and the mating surface is used to abut and mate with the rib. This arrangement only requires the abutment of the rib and the mating surface to achieve the purpose of sealing, which can reduce the processing precision requirements of the second valve body and improve the reliability of the line-surface sealing.
[0014] Furthermore, a groove is formed in the wall of the accommodating chamber, the groove being opposite to the entrance of the exhaust air passage. The side of the groove facing the exhaust air passage forms an accommodating portion, which is used to accommodate the second valve body in the exhaust state. This arrangement can accommodate the second valve body in the exhaust state, thereby forming a labyrinth groove sealing structure between the second valve body and the wall of the accommodating chamber, preventing indoor air discharged through the air outlet side from flowing back into the air guide chamber through the gap between the second valve body and the wall.
[0015] Furthermore, the fresh air device also includes a second valve, which is movably connected to the housing; in the exhaust state, the second valve connects the sewage exhaust passage and the first air outlet, and closes the fresh air inlet passage from the first air outlet to the air inlet side; in the fresh air state, the second valve connects the first air outlet and the air inlet side, and blocks the sewage exhaust passage and the first air outlet. This arrangement of the fresh air device utilizes the same first and second air outlets to achieve the purpose of both introducing fresh air into the room and exhausting indoor air to the outside, without the need for separate air inlet and exhaust ducts and corresponding connection structures, thereby simplifying the structure of the fresh air device and reducing the cost of the fresh air device.

[0030] Example 1
[0031] Figure 1 This is a cross-sectional view of the structure of the fresh air device 010 provided in the first embodiment when the first valve 300 is in the exhaust state. Figure 1 , Figure 2 for Figure 1 A magnified view of the local structure at point A. Figure 3 This is a cross-sectional view of the structure of the fresh air device 010 provided in the first embodiment when the first valve 300 is in the exhaust state. Figure 2 .like Figures 1 to 3 As shown, this embodiment provides a fresh air device 010, including a housing 100, a fan assembly 200 and a first valve 300. Specifically, the housing 100 is provided with an exhaust port 131 and a first air port 121. The exhaust port 131 is connected to the indoor room, and the first air port 121 is connected to the outdoor room. The fan assembly 200 is arranged in the inner cavity of the housing 100. The fan assembly 200 has an air inlet side 210 and an air outlet side 220. The first valve 300 has an exhaust state for exhausting indoor air through the first air port 121. In the exhaust state, the first valve 300 opens the exhaust port 131 to connect the indoor room with the air inlet side 210, closes the air flow channel from the air outlet side 220 to the indoor room, and connects the sewage air channel 123 from the air outlet side 220 to the first air port 121. When the first valve 300 is in the exhaust state, the fresh air device 010 is in the exhaust mode. Figure 1 and Figure 3The arrow in the figure indicates the air flow path of the fresh air device 010 in the exhaust mode, and the air flow path shown by the dotted line indicates that this section is blocked by the sewage exhaust channel 123 between the air outlet side 220 and the first air outlet 121.
[0032] When it is necessary to use the fresh air device 010 to exhaust the indoor air to the outside, the first valve 300 can be switched to the exhaust state ( Figure 1 and Figure 3 At this time, the first valve 300 opens the exhaust port 131 to connect the indoor room with the air inlet side 210, closes the air flow channel from the air outlet side 220 to the indoor room, and connects the sewage air channel 123 from the air outlet side 220 to the first air port 121, so that the indoor air can flow from the exhaust port 131 to the air inlet side 210 under the action of the fan assembly 200, and when the above-mentioned air flows out from the air outlet side 220, it will not enter the room, but will flow to the first air port 121 through the sewage air channel 123 to be discharged to the outdoors.
[0033] The above-mentioned setting of the fresh air device 010 can not only discharge indoor air to the outdoors, reduce the carbon dioxide concentration in the room and improve comfort, but also make the three channels from the exhaust port 131 to the air inlet side 210, the air outlet side 220 to the room and the air outlet side 220 to the first air outlet 121 be arranged adjacent to each other, so that the various air flow channels of the fresh air device are arranged reasonably and compactly. Only by using the first valve 300 in the exhaust state, the opening or closing of the three channels from the exhaust port 131 to the air inlet side 210, the air outlet side 220 to the room and the air outlet side 220 to the first air outlet 121 can be managed. The design is ingenious, the valve structure is simple and the reliability is high.
[0034] Please continue to refer to Figure 3 In this embodiment, a waste air inlet channel 122 is formed between the exhaust port 131 and the air inlet side 210 . In the exhaust state, indoor air enters the waste air inlet channel 122 through the exhaust port 131 and flows toward the air inlet side 210 along the waste air inlet channel 122 .
[0035] Figure 4 This is a structural cross-sectional view of the fresh air device 010 provided in the first embodiment when the first valve 300 is in the fresh air state. Figure 5 for Figure 4 A magnified view of the local structure at B in the figure. Figure 4 and Figure 5 As shown, the first valve 300 also has a fresh air state that allows outdoor air to enter the room. In the fresh air state, the first valve 300 closes the exhaust port 131 to block the room from the air inlet side 210, opens the air flow channel from the air outlet side 220 to the room, and closes the sewage air channel 123 from the air outlet side 220 to the first air port 121. When the first valve 300 is in the fresh air state, the fresh air device 010 is in the fresh air mode. Figure 4The arrows in represent the airflow path of the fresh air device 010 in the fresh air mode.
[0036] Please continue to refer to Figure 4 When the first valve 300 is in the fresh air state, the fresh air entering through the air inlet side 210 of the fan assembly 200 is discharged from the air outlet side 220 and then discharged into the room, thus providing fresh air to the room. During this process, the first valve 300 closes the air outlet 131, preventing indoor air from entering the sewage air inlet duct 122 through the air outlet 131. At the same time, the first valve 300 also cuts off the sewage air outlet duct 123 from the air outlet side 220 to the first air outlet 121, preventing the fresh air discharged from the air outlet side 220 from returning to the first air outlet 121 through the sewage air outlet duct 123. This ensures that the fresh air, after being discharged from the air outlet side 220, flows into the room.
[0037] That is to say, when the first valve 300 is in the fresh air state, it is still possible to manage the opening or closing of the three channels from the exhaust port 131 to the air inlet side 210, the air outlet side 220 to the indoor space, and the air outlet side 220 to the first air port 121, thereby meeting the fresh air supply function of the fresh air device 010.
[0038] Please continue to refer to Figure 1 and Figure 3 In this embodiment, the inner cavity of the shell 100 includes an air guide cavity 110 and an accommodating cavity 120 separated by a partition 130, wherein the cavity wall of the air guide cavity 110 is provided with a second air outlet 111 directly connected to the indoor room; the fan assembly 200 is arranged in the accommodating cavity 120, the sewage air discharge channel 123 is formed in the accommodating cavity 120, and the first air outlet 121 is opened in the cavity wall of the accommodating cavity 120; the air outlet 131 is opened on the partition 130, and the partition 130 is also provided with an air inlet 132.
[0039] When the exhaust function of the fresh air device 010 is needed, the first valve 300 is switched to the exhaust state. Under the action of the fan assembly 200, a negative pressure is formed on the air inlet side 210 of the fan assembly 200, and the indoor air will enter the air guide cavity 110 through the second air outlet 111, and further flow to the sewage air inlet channel 122 in the accommodating cavity 120 through the air outlet 131 opened on the partition 130; when the air flow gradually flows to the air inlet side 210, it will be discharged from the air outlet side 220. Since the first valve 300 has closed the air inlet 132 at this time, the air flow channel from the air outlet side 220 to the indoor room is blocked. Therefore, after the air flow is discharged through the air outlet side 220, it will enter the sewage air channel 123, and flow along the sewage air channel 123 to the first air outlet 121, and then be discharged to the outdoors from the first air outlet 121.
[0040] This setting form of the fresh air device 010 uses a partition 130 to separate the inner cavity of the shell 100 into an air guide cavity 110 directly connected to the indoor room, and a accommodating cavity 120 directly connected to the outdoor room, and by providing an exhaust port 131 and an air inlet 132 on the partition 130, it ensures that indoor air is discharged to the outdoors and outdoor air is supplied to the indoor room, and the structure is simple.
[0041] Please continue to refer to Figure 1 and Figure 3 In this embodiment, the first valve 300 is movably arranged on the partition 130. The first valve 300 includes a first valve body 310 and a second valve body 320 connected at an angle. The second valve body 320 is opposite to the entrance of the exhaust air channel 123. In the exhaust state, the first valve body 310 closes the air inlet 132 and exposes the exhaust port 131. The second valve body 320 connects the air outlet side 220 with the exhaust air channel 123. Please continue to refer to Figure 4 In the fresh air state, the first valve body 310 exposes the air inlet 132 and closes the air outlet 131 , and the second valve body 320 blocks the air outlet side 220 and the sewage air discharge channel 123 .
[0042] This arrangement of the first valve 300 allows it to switch between the exhaust state and the fresh air state through a simple movement process, and the control method is simple.
[0043] Please continue to refer to Figure 3 and Figure 4 In this embodiment, the air inlet 132 and the air outlet 131 are arranged at intervals along the moving direction of the first valve 300. That is, along the moving direction of the first valve 300, the air inlet 132 and the air outlet 131 are arranged in a straight line.
[0044] This arrangement of the air inlet 132 and the air outlet 131 can reduce the width of the first valve body 310, so that the first valve body 310 can meet the requirements of closing the exhaust port 131 and exposing the air inlet 132 or closing the air inlet 132 and exposing the air outlet 131 after movement with a smaller width, which is conducive to the compact structural design of the shell 100.
[0045] Here, “the width dimension of the first valve body 310 ” refers to the dimension of the first valve body 310 in a direction perpendicular to the moving direction thereof and parallel to the partition plate 130 .
[0046] In other embodiments, the exhaust port 131 and the air inlet 132 may be arranged in a staggered manner along the moving direction of the first valve body 310. In this case, the exhaust port 131 and the air inlet 132 are spaced apart not only along the moving direction of the first valve body 310 but also along the width direction of the first valve body 310. The width dimension of the first valve body 310 is appropriately increased so that the exhaust port 131 can be covered in the fresh air state.
[0047] Please continue to refer to Figure 2 and Figure 5 In this embodiment, the first valve body 310 is vertically connected to the second valve body 320 . The second valve body 320 is a plate-shaped structure. The side of the second valve body 320 facing the exhaust air channel 123 is used to close the exhaust air channel 123 .
[0048] Through the above arrangement, when the first valve 300 moves to the fresh air state, the sewage exhaust passage 123 can be closed by using the side of the second valve body 320 facing the sewage exhaust passage 123. The structure is simple, which is conducive to reducing the cost of the first valve 300.
[0049] In this embodiment, the first valve body 310 is also a plate-shaped structure. This configuration not only ensures the reliability of sealing or exposing the exhaust port 131 and the air inlet 132, but also further simplifies the structure of the first valve 300, thereby further reducing the cost of the first valve 300.
[0050] Please continue to refer to Figure 5 In this embodiment, the sewage exhaust channel 123 is partially recessed in a direction away from the second valve body 320 at a position surrounding its inlet, forming a matching stop 127; in the fresh air state, the second valve body 320 is embedded in the matching stop 127.
[0051] By setting the second valve body 320 to be embedded in the matching stop 127 in the fresh air state, after the fresh air is discharged from the air outlet side 220, the second valve body 320 can utilize the embedding effect with the matching stop 127 to form a labyrinth groove sealing structure at the entrance of the sewage air channel 123 to prevent the fresh air from leaking into the sewage air channel 123, thereby ensuring the amount of fresh air supplied to the room.
[0052] In this embodiment, in the fresh air state, the second valve body 320 is completely embedded in the mating stop 127, and the surface of the second valve body 320 facing away from the sewage air channel 123 is coplanar with the inner surface of the volute of the fan assembly 200, so that after the fresh air is discharged from the air outlet side 220, it will not be blocked by the second valve body 320, thereby reducing the wind resistance during the fresh air outlet process and ensuring the smoothness of the fresh air outlet.
[0053] Please continue to refer to Figure 2 and Figure 5 In this embodiment, the second valve body 320 includes a connecting edge 321 and a sealing edge 322. Specifically, the connecting edge 321 is used to connect with the first valve body 310, and the sealing edge 322 is provided with a rib 323 along its direction, and the rib 323 is located on the side of the second valve body 320 facing the sewage air discharge channel 123; the mating surface 128 is formed on the surface of the stop 127 facing the second valve body 320, wherein the mating surface 128 is used to abut and mate with the rib 323.
[0054] In this embodiment, the second valve body 320 is a rectangular plate-shaped structure. The second valve body 320 has four sides, one of which is a connecting side 321 for connecting to the first valve body 310 , and the other three sides are sealing sides 322 .
[0055] By providing a rib 323 on the sealing edge 322 of the second valve body 320, the sewage air duct 123 is closed by utilizing the abutment fit between the rib 323 and the mating surface 128 of the mating stop 127. On the one hand, the sealing purpose can be achieved by simply ensuring the abutment fit between the rib 323 and the mating surface 128, which can reduce the machining accuracy requirements for the second valve body 320, and the line-surface sealing reliability is higher. On the other hand, the rib 323 can also be utilized to improve the structural strength of the second valve body 320, reduce the deformation caused by the second valve body 320, and thus extend the service life of the first valve 300.
[0056] Please continue to refer to Figure 2 In this embodiment, a groove 124 can be opened in the cavity wall of the accommodating cavity 120. Specifically, the groove 124 is opposite to the entrance of the exhaust air channel 123, and the groove 124 forms an accommodating portion on the side facing the exhaust air channel 123, wherein the accommodating portion is used to accommodate the second valve body 320 in the exhaust state.
[0057] The setting of the above-mentioned groove 124 can accommodate the second valve body 320 in the exhaust state, thereby forming a labyrinth groove sealing structure between the second valve body 320 and the cavity wall of the accommodating cavity 120, preventing the indoor air discharged through the air outlet side 220 from flowing back to the air guide cavity 110 through the gap between the second valve body 320 and the cavity wall, thereby ensuring the exhaust efficiency.
[0058] Please continue to refer to Figure 1 、 Figure 3 and Figure 4 There are two second air vents 111, which are located at different positions of the air guide cavity 110. Specifically, in this embodiment, the two second air vents 111 are disposed opposite to each other, for discharging air toward the fresh air device 010 in two opposite directions.
[0059] The above-mentioned setting not only ensures the fresh air volume and exhaust efficiency by increasing the number of the second air outlets 111, but also utilizes the different orientations of the second air outlets 111 to achieve the purpose of the fresh air device 010 blowing fresh air in different directions and introducing indoor air at different positions into the air guide cavity 110, so that the indoor environment can meet user needs in a shorter time, thereby improving the user experience.
[0060] Please continue to refer to Figure 1 、 Figure 3 and Figure 4In this embodiment, the fresh air device 010 may further include a second valve 400. Specifically, the second valve 400 is movably connected to the shell 100. In the exhaust state, the second valve 400 connects the sewage exhaust channel 123 and the first air outlet 121, and closes the fresh air inlet channel 126 from the first air outlet 121 to the air inlet side 210. In the fresh air state, the second valve 400 connects the first air outlet 121 and the air inlet side 210, and blocks the sewage exhaust channel 123 and the first air outlet 121.
[0061] When it is necessary to introduce fresh air into the room, the first valve 300 can be made to close the exhaust vent 131 to block the air guide chamber 110 and the air inlet side 210, and the air inlet 132 can be opened to connect the outlet side 220 to the fresh air exhaust channel 125 of the air guide chamber 110. At the same time, the sewage air channel 123 from the outlet side 220 to the first air vent 121 is closed, and the second valve 400 connects the first air vent 121 and the air inlet side 210, and blocks the sewage air channel 123 from the first air vent 121, so that outdoor air enters through the first air vent 121, flows to the air inlet side 210 of the fan assembly 200 through the fresh air inlet channel 126, and under the action of the fan assembly 200, flows into the fresh air exhaust channel 125 from the air outlet side 220 of the fan assembly 200, and enters the air guide chamber 110 through the air inlet 132, and is finally discharged to the room through the second air vent 111, thereby achieving the purpose of introducing fresh air into the room.
[0062] When it is necessary to discharge the indoor air to the outside, the first valve 300 can open the exhaust port 131 to connect the air guide cavity 110 to the sewage air inlet channel 122 on the air inlet side 210, close the air inlet 132 to cut off the fresh air inlet channel 126 from the air outlet side 220 to the air guide cavity 110, and open the sewage air channel 123 from the air outlet side 220 to the first air port 121. The second valve 400 connects the sewage air channel 123 with the first air port 121 and closes the first air port 121. The fresh air inlet 121 is connected to the fresh air inlet duct 126 on the air inlet side 210, so that the indoor air enters the air guide cavity 110 through the second air outlet 111, enters the sewage air inlet duct 122 through the air outlet 131, and then flows toward the air inlet side 210 of the fan assembly 200. Under the action of the fan assembly 200, it flows into the sewage air outlet duct 123 from the air outlet side 220 of the fan assembly 200, and is finally discharged to the outside through the first air outlet 121, thereby achieving the purpose of discharging the indoor air to the outside.
[0063] This setting form of the fresh air device 010 can achieve the purpose of both introducing fresh air into the room and exhausting indoor air to the outside by utilizing the same first air outlet 121 and second air outlet 111, without the need to set up separate air inlet ducts and exhaust ducts and corresponding connecting structures, thereby simplifying the structure of the fresh air device 010 and reducing the cost of the fresh air device 010.
[0064] Please continue to refer to Figure 4In this embodiment, the fresh air device 010 is provided with a filter component 500, and the filter component 500 is located between the first air outlet 121 and the air inlet side 210, and is used to filter the outdoor air entering through the first air outlet 121 in the fresh air mode to make it fresh air.
[0065] Example 2
[0066] Figure 6 This is a cross-sectional view of the structure of the fresh air device 010 provided in the second embodiment when the first valve 300 is in the exhaust state. Figure 6 As shown, this embodiment provides another fresh air device 010. The working principle of the fresh air device 010 in the exhaust mode and the working principle in the fresh air mode are the same as the working principle of the fresh air device 010 in the exhaust mode and the working principle in the fresh air mode provided in the above-mentioned embodiment 1. The only difference is as described below.
[0067] Please continue to refer to Figure 6 In this embodiment, a blocking member 324 is provided on the side of the second valve body 320 facing the sewage exhaust air channel 123. Specifically, the blocking member 324 is spaced apart from the first valve body 310 to form an avoidance gap 325 between the blocking member 324 and the first valve body 310; a guide surface 326 is formed on the surface of the blocking member 324 facing the sewage exhaust air channel 123, which is used to guide the airflow from the air outlet side 220 to the sewage exhaust air channel 123.
[0068] When the first valve 300 switches from the exhaust state to the fresh air state, as the first valve 300 moves on the partition 130, the second valve body 320 will gradually approach the sewage exhaust passage 123. When the second valve body 320 moves to the entrance of the sewage exhaust passage 123, the blocking member 324 will be inserted into the sewage exhaust passage 123. At the same time, the upper passage wall of the sewage exhaust passage 123 will be inserted into the avoidance gap 325, so that the avoidance gap 325 effectively avoids the sewage exhaust passage 123 and prevents movement interference.
[0069] The setting form of the above-mentioned second valve body 320 can also effectively block the sewage air channel 123 in the fresh air state. Moreover, it can also utilize the guide surface 326 set on the blocking member 324 to guide the air flow from the air outlet side 220 to the sewage air channel 123, so that in the exhaust mode, the indoor air discharged through the air outlet side 220 can flow smoothly to the sewage air channel 123, thereby improving the smoothness of the exhaust.
